I enjoyed the film (on Netflix).
- Right away there was a combination of different kinds of comedy.
The narrator had witty remarks about the traditional romantic female heroine (Linda's character).
But this clashed with the reality of fearing being robbed and pepper spraying a former student.

And that contrast between old fashioned romance and gritty events that can happen in a US high school was a good part of the fun.

- Next was Nathan Lane's performance as the drama teacher; over the top and exaggerated.
I've known people like this (since I've been involved in some student productions).

- The cast was good, and the photography and direction worked.

* I've seen a lot of English TV romances with my wife. And "The English Teacher" was a nice change of pace.

7/10.
